It is interesting also, that with that user's system, the Samsung 960 Evo 1TB drive is outbenching the Samsung 960 Evo 500GB drive. This seems consistent with that I have found: My Samsung 960 Evo 500 GB drive is outbenching my Samsung 960 Evo 250 GB drive. It seems that the smaller drives are slower than their larger ones. Probably batching or something like that I guess. I was perhaps naive to think that all 960 Evo's would perform the same, just with different capacities...
